What does Reddit do?
Reddit, Inc. operates a website that organizes digital communities. It organizes communities based on specific interests that enable users to engage in conversations by sharing experiences, submitting links, uploading images and videos, and replying to one another. Does Reddit have a lot of debt?
No, Reddit has low debt relative to equity. The debt-to-equity ratio (D/E — interest-bearing debt to equity) is 10%. For the kommunikation sector, anything below 80% counts as low debt. Note: D/E levels are highly sector-specific — a bank at 300% debt is normal, a tech stock at 300% is extremely leveraged. Always compare with similar companies in the same sector.
